The Kansas City Chiefs’ efforts to rebuild their offensive line have taken a bearish turn, as the three-time AFC champions have sent one of their linemen to Chicago.

Multiple sources are reporting that the Chiefs have agreed to send offensive guard Joe Thuney to the Chicago Bears in exchange for the Bears’ fourth-round pick in the 2026 draft. Thuney spent the second part of last season, including the playoffs, as the starting left tackle, as injuries throughout the season eventually led to the Chiefs’ line being overwhelmed by Philadelphia’s defense in Super Bowl 59. The 33-year-old Thuney has one year remaining on his current deal. The trade comes as the Chiefs have placed their franchise tag on right guard Trey Smith.
